Lyophilized (freeze-dried) powder: Room temperature storage: stable for weeks to months depending on peptide Refrigerator storage (2-8 C): stable for months to over a year Freezer storage (-20 C): stable for years in some cases Keep sealed, dry, and away from light Moisture is the primary enemy of lyophilized peptides Reconstituted solution: Must be refrigerated at 2-8 C at all times Typical stability: 4-6 weeks for most peptides Never freeze reconstituted solutions Use bacteriostatic water (not sterile water) for multi-use vials Each needle puncture introduces contamination risk The difference in stability is dramatic
